    Condition: Very Good. [Druskininkai, Lithuania?]: 1968. Large oblong folio (30x41.50cm.); commemorative postbound photo album of brown blind-embossed cloth; [29] grey card leaves to which are mounted 30 original photographs measuring ca.15x24cm (or the inverse) to 30x24cm, all captioned in neat manuscript Russian, though the opening statement on front pastedown in manuscript Lithuanian of the same hand. Corners a bit bumped, pastedown endpapers starting to peel from boards, light occasional soil to leaves, leaves cockled from exposure to glue, else Very Good, the photographs all in near fine condition. Collection of neatly compiled but rather amateurish photographs taken during the 50th anniversary of the Russian Revolution celebration in the Lithuanian spa town of Druskininkai, featuring members of both the military, the Young Leninists (Komsomol), and the Pioneers. The earliest photos show the visit of Anna Vasil'evna, mother of the fallen hero Petr Naboichenko at the company with which he served, her face shown weeping before an oversized portrait of her son. Vasil'evna reappears in one more photograph towards the end of the album, sitting in a classroom surrounded by listeners as she wipes her eyes with a handkerchief. The photos also depict the march to the burial place of Naboichenko at which is held a rally of soldiers and members of the Pioneers in memory of those who fell during the liberation of Druskininkai. Other photos show members of the party in an empty field, "the site of a fierce battle" (our translation). The final photographs promote the importance of the press, as a man in military uniform reads from the day's newspaper to a small cluster of soldiers, some of them looking as young as fourteen. The final photo, taken at the evening's banquet, show a four-man military band on maracas, bass, accordion, and guitar, the caption describing them as the prizewinners of a televised competition. (Kind thanks to our colleague Dr. Joseph Kellner for his assistance in the translating and cataloging of this item.).
